MQTT是一种轻量级、开放式的通信协议,通常用于物联网(IoT)设备之间的通信。MQTT代表消息队列遥测传输(Message Queuing Telemetry Transport),最初由IBM在1999年开发。MQTT协议允许设备和应用程序通过中介代理服务器进行双向通信,通过订阅和发布消息的方式实现通信。MQTT协议的轻量级和可扩展性使其成为IoT应用程序的理想选择。该协议具有高效性、可靠性和安全性,并且支持多种网络协议。
根据官方文档描述,boolean类型经过编译之后采用int来定义(所以此时boolean占4字节,32bits)。如果是boolean数组则占1字节(8 bits)。
MD5 是一种散列函数,其作用是将输入的任意长度数据映射为一个固定长度的输出,通常是128位。MD5 函数不可逆,意味着无法通过其输出反推输入的原始数据。
Java的点在多边形内的算法通常采用射线法(也称射线交叉算法)来实现。该算法基于以下原理:如果一个点在多边形内部,则从该点画一条水平向右的射线,与多边形相交的次数为奇数;如果在多边形外部,则相交次数为偶数;如果在多边形边界上,则相交次数不确定,有时为偶数,有时为奇数。
同学,你好!相信大家在了解网站布局时,必然听到过自适应和响应式,很多同学对自适应和响应式的区别并不是很了解,其实简单来说就是开发界面数量上的区别。那么具体来说,二者的区别有哪些呢?学习相关的设计,可以通过哪个渠道来学呢?